4. Customer and citizen data rights

 

As provided for by the data protection regulations, you have many rights related to the provision of your personal data to the company EUROLAMP SA, using it and this website. These rights include asking the company EUROLAMP SA to:

 

• confirm to you what personal data it may hold about you, if any, and for what purposes.

 

• change the consent you have provided in relation to your personal data.

 

• correct any inaccurate or incomplete personal data that may be held about you.

 

• provide you with a full copy of your personal data to transfer it elsewhere.

 

• stop processing your personal data while an objection by you exists/is being resolved.

• permanently erase all your personal data and confirm to you that it has done so (unless there is a valid reason why we cannot do so).

To contact EUROLAMP ABEE, please refer to Section 9 below. If EUROLAMP ABEE does not respond to your request, or does not provide you with a valid reason why it is unable to do so, you have the right to contact the Personal Data Protection Authority to make a complaint.

 

You can contact them via their website (www.dpa.gr) or by telephone (+30 210-6475600), or in writing to their address (Kifissias 1-3, PO Box 115 23 Athens).
